Hi everyone, I have a question regarding SSHRC. Back in February, I received a letter from my university saying that my application was not being forwarded on to Ottawa for SSHRC. On March 1st, however, I received an email from SSHRC saying that they had received my application. I called my Faculty of Graduate Studies, and all they could tell me was that my application had in fact been forwarded. Does anyone know if this may mean I was forwarded on as an alternate? It appears as though most people who were initially forwarded on by their universities had received a confirmation email from SSHRC back in February. What do you suppose it means that I did not hear from SSHRC until March 1st? Thanks for any help!

You were probably forwarded as an alternate. I received word from my school (Ryerson) in February that I wasn't one of the 27 (our school's quota) that got forwarded on for the $17,500 scholarship, but that I did get forwarded as an alternate. They told me that if any additional scholarships became available or people declined, I might get one.

Oh, and I got the email on March 1st too. So we're in the same boat! =)
